mysql是怎样运行的-从根上理解mysq 小孩子 pdf文档
时间: 2024-01-25 19:00:48 浏览: 173
MySQL是一个开源的关系型数据库管理系统,它由后台服务器和前端客户端组成。MySQL的后台服务器包括一系列表和进程,它们负责处理数据的存储、检索和管理。
当用户通过客户端应用程序发送请求给MySQL服务器时,服务器会先进行连接认证,然后根据请求的内容执行相应的SQL语句。服务器通过解析和执行SQL语句来读取或更改数据库中的数据,然后将结果返回给客户端。
在MySQL中,数据存储在表中,每个表都有一个结构定义和数据内容。表的结构定义包括表的字段、数据类型、索引等信息,而数据内容则是实际存储的数据记录。
MySQL通过存储引擎来管理数据的存储和检索,不同的存储引擎有不同的特性和优缺点。常见的存储引擎包括InnoDB、MyISAM等,它们可以根据业务需求来选择合适的存储引擎。
除了基本的数据存储和检索功能,MySQL还提供了事务管理、安全性、备份恢复等高级功能。通过事务管理,用户可以执行一组SQL语句,要么全部执行成功,要么全部执行失败,确保数据的完整性和一致性。
总的来说,MySQL是通过后台服务器处理SQL语句,操作数据库的存储、检索和管理。同时,MySQL也提供了丰富的功能和灵活的配置选项,能够满足不同场景下的业务需求。
相关问题
The service already exists! The current server installed: C:\Users\lenovo\Desktop\开发工具\mysql-8.0.16-winx64\mysql-8.0.16-winx64\bin\mysq
这个问题是关于MySQL服务的安装和检查。如果你再次尝试安装MySQL服务,会提示服务已经存在,而且会告诉你当前已经安装的服务的路径。在你的情况下,MySQL服务已经安装在路径C:\Users\lenovo\Desktop\开发工具\mysql-8.0.16-winx64\mysql-8.0.16-winx64\bin\mysq?下。
阅读全文